Gilbert Nijay Sprague

Gilbert Nijay Sprague of Owendale, age 69, passed away on Monday, July 20, 2026 at his home surrounded by his family. He was born on May 20, 1957 in Pigeon, the son of the late Gilbert G. and Florence M. (Groh) Sprague. Gil graduated from Owendale Gagetown High School with the class of 1976. It was in high school he met the love of his life, the former Joy Engelhardt. They were united in marriage on December 18, 1976. Together they shared nearly fifty years, two children, and countless memories.

Gil first worked at the Thumb Cooperative Terminal before spending 40 years at the Co-op Elevator in Elkton, where he retired. He was a former member of the Owendale Lions Club and enjoyed attending church and practicing his faith. Gil was an avid hunter and fisherman. He loved hunting deer and turkeys and fishing until the sun went down. He especially enjoyed his fishing walleye tournaments with his teacher, Manuel Thies, and later with his brother, Brad. He was always willing to teach others to hunt and fish, especially children, helping pass those traditions on to the next generation.

Gil loved spending time with his grandchildren and was proud of them, often sharing stories about them. Although he was quiet and reserved, he could strike up a conversation with anyone and was remembered for the stories he shared. He also loved his dogs and treated them like members of the family. Gil's hard work, quiet strength, occasional stubbornness, and, above all, his love for his family will be deeply missed.
